Journal de Culture - Dognabis CupVariété : Diesel Jealousy (Autofloraison) Semaine 4 - 1ère Semaine de Floraison Date : 15 octobre 2025Observations :Les plantes ont doublé de taille grâce au stretch typique de la phase de floraison. État des plantes : saines et vigoureuses, aucun stress observé cette semaine. Paramètres ajustés :PPFD augmenté à 800 (cible atteinte selon les données). VPD réglé autour de 1,0-1,1 kPa (cible atteinte, valeurs mesurées : 1,06 kPa jour, 1,09 kPa nuit). Température moyenne : 24,4 °C (jour), 22,5 °C (nuit) - cible stable. Humidité moyenne : 65,22 % (jour), 59,98 % (nuit) - ajustée pour maintenir le VPD. CO2 : ~900 PPM (cible atteinte). Solution : eau claire Notes :Les paramètres ont été optimisés cette semaine avec une augmentation de la lumière (PPFD) et un réglage précis du VPD, adapté au cycle automatique. Aucune intervention stressante, les plantes répondent bien aux conditions. Objectif pour la semaine prochaine :Maintenir les mêmes paramètres : PPFD à 800, VPD autour de 1,0-1,1 kPa, température et humidité stables, sans stress supplémentaire.

4/6/2024 - Vegetation Week 8 Day 1- Last week in VEG, They are all looking amazing and no worry about stretch when I flip Next Saturday they are indica and I have more than 50% of distance from the top of the plant to the lights with a little more I can raise the lights if necessary. So going to really just enjoy this last week of VEG, and get my Cloning equipment ready. I will be taking 2 cuts for each this is also a PHENO hunt for HWG and he not only has the prize for the winner but he also has an additional bounty on a cut of the winner. I did have to take some from around the edges to keep them from touching. 4/7/2024 - Vegetation Week 8 Day 2- Didn't do anything today but watch them grow.. They will be getting a really good flip trim and clean up for clone material on Friday/ Saturday. 4/8/2024 - Vegetation Week 8 Day 3- Couldn't even get a picture of the #1 at first too much Foliage throughout.. So I had to clean that up and make sure they all still have some separation before flip. 4/9/2024 - Vegetation Week 8 Day 4- Huston we almost had an issue.. I looked at my Res and she was in desperate need of 10 gallons to get her through until next water change on Saturday. So I added 10 gallons and the Nutes. I added 10 Gallons of Water I added the following Nutes: CalMag= 1.00Mil/Gal= 10Mil FloraMicro = 5.4Mil/Gal= 54Mil FloraGro= 4.2Mil/Gal= 42Mil FLoraBloom= 4.6Mil/Gal= 46Mil 4/10/2024 - Vegetation Week 8 Day 5- Had to giver them a huge clean up today I couldn't even see the numbers in the first pic. I am also worried that #1 and #3 really, really are getting huge over the last few days.. starting to think I should have flipped them this past Saturday.. The interesting things is even though this is an Indica Strain, I might have to super crop just to keep them off the lights. The joys and sorrows of RDWC and timing. 4/11/2024 - Vegetation Week 8 Day 6- Even though Flipping in Two days almost wish I would have gone at Week 7. I am really worried about #3, #1 and #2 are huge and when I put them in flower they are going to stretch out 4/12/2024 - Vegetation Week 8 Day 7- Day of Work.. Lots of Work.. I gave all three a Cloning/Flower cleaning.. all three got cleaned up top Inside and bottom, I took 2 cuts of each to see which one come out on top then I will kill off the other cuts once I have a winner in flower. I clean up this thoroughly before I flip because it reduces the work load on the next major clean up I do on Week 4 of Flower.and they are so much taller that it is going to be a pain in the ass to maintain canopy space for #3, we will see how it goes and adjust as necessary..

Temperature influences the rate of enzymatic reactions involved in aerobic respiration. Enzymes, such as those involved in glycolysis, the Krebs cycle, and the electron transport chain, work most efficiently at an optimal temperature range. In low temperatures, enzymatic activity will slow down, thus reducing the rate of aerobic respiration. In high temperatures, enzymes can become denatured, thus impairing their function and stopping the process of aerobic respiration. Glucose is the primary fuel for aerobic respiration. The rate of aerobic respiration increases with the availability of glucose, as it is the starting point for glycolysis. If glucose levels are low, cells may rely on alternative energy sources such as fatty acids or amino acids , but these processes may yield less ATP or be less efficient. The Soil-Plant-Atmosphere Continuum (SPAC) describes the continuous pathway and process of water movement, driven by a gradient in water potential, from the soil, through the plant's roots, stem, and leaves, and finally evaporating into the atmosphere through transpiration. There is evaporation, there is transpiration, and then there is evapotranspiration; Evapotranspiration (ET) is the combined total of two processes: evaporation (water lost directly from soil and surface water into the atmosphere) and transpiration (water released from plants to the atmosphere through their leaves). Evapotranspiration represents the total amount of water that moves from the medium into the air. When water stagnates in a medium, it loses oxygen, creating anaerobic conditions that foster the growth of harmful microorganisms like bacteria and fungi, which can produce toxins and disease vectors. Thigmomorphogenesis, the process by which plants respond to mechanical stimuli like touch by altering their growth and development, results in significant morphological changes to improve survival against mechanical perturbations. This complex response involves sensing touch and initiating physiological and genetic responses, leading to changes in form and structure over days or weeks. The process is triggered by physical forces such as wind, rain, or touch. Plants adapt to these stimuli by changing their shape and structure, which may include slower growth, thickened stems, or altered leaf development. Plants possess sophisticated mechanisms to detect even subtle mechanical stimuli and initiate responses. A variety of molecules, including calcium ions, jasmonates, ethylene, and nitric oxide, are involved in signaling these mechanical inputs. Touch can induce the expression of genes that encode proteins for calcium sensing, cell wall modification, and defense mechanisms. A plant exposed to constant wind may become shorter and sturdier. A plant that is touched frequently might grow more slowly to conserve energy and develop thicker cell walls. These changes increase a plant's resilience and ability to survive in harsh environments.
